createssh Fundamentals Explained
createssh Fundamentals Explained
Blog Article
The moment the general public essential has actually been configured to the server, the server allows any connecting user which includes the non-public essential to log in. In the login approach, the consumer proves possession with the personal crucial by digitally signing The main element exchange.
Open your ~/.ssh/config file, then modify the file to consist of the following traces. In case your SSH vital file has a distinct identify or route than the example code, modify the filename or route to match your recent setup.
We'll make use of the >> redirect symbol to append the content material as opposed to overwriting it. This can allow us to include keys with out destroying previously included keys.
Hence, the SSH critical authentication is more secure than password authentication and arguably much more handy.
rsa - an aged algorithm dependant on The problem of factoring massive quantities. A critical measurement of at the very least 2048 bits is recommended for RSA; 4096 bits is healthier. RSA is finding previous and sizeable advancements are now being produced in factoring.
Any time you generate an SSH critical, you are able to add a passphrase to even more protected The true secret. Whenever you use the critical, you need to enter the passphrase.
It can be encouraged to enter a password here For an additional layer of stability. By environment a password, you could potentially avert unauthorized access to your servers and createssh accounts if anyone ever will get a keep of one's personal SSH vital or your machine.
In this way, even if one of these is compromised someway, another supply of randomness must continue to keep the keys secure.
Our advice is to gather randomness over the total installation in the operating process, help you save that randomness inside of a random seed file. Then boot the technique, collect some additional randomness throughout the boot, combine while in the saved randomness in the seed file, and only then crank out the host keys.
-t “Variety” This selection specifies the type of crucial to get designed. Normally applied values are: - rsa for RSA keys - dsa for DSA keys - ecdsa for elliptic curve DSA keys
Add your SSH personal important into the ssh-agent and keep your passphrase in the keychain. When you produced your key with a different title, or if you are introducing an existing critical which includes a distinct identify, change id_ed25519
In this article, you've got discovered ways to deliver SSH important pairs applying ssh-keygen. SSH keys have numerous positive aspects over passwords:
A much better solution should be to automate introducing keys, keep passwords, and to specify which vital to work with when accessing particular servers.
Safe shell (SSH) would be the encrypted protocol accustomed to log in to user accounts on distant Linux or Unix-like pcs. Generally this sort of consumer accounts are secured making use of passwords. Whenever you log in to the distant Laptop, you need to offer the person title and password for your account you are logging in to.